An adult takes roughly 12 breaths each minute, inhaling approximately 500mL with each breath. Oxygen and carbon dioxide are exchanged in the lungs. The amount of nitrogen exhaled equals the amount inhaled, and the mole fraction of nitrogen in the exhaled air is 0.75. The exhaled air is saturated with water vapor at body temperature, 37°C. Estimate the increase in the rate of water loss (g/day) when a person breathing air at 23°C and a relative humidity of 50% enters an airplane in which the temperature is also 23°C but the relative humidity is 10%.
